Selecting a serrated gasket isn't just about picking a sealing component off the shelf; it's about understanding the unique demands of your application to prevent leaks and ensure long-term reliability. For instance, in high-pressure systems like those in oil and gas pipelines, the sharp teeth of a serrated gasket bite into flange surfaces, creating a tighter seal that resists blowouts. In contrast, softer gaskets might compress too much and fail under such extreme conditions. Think of it as matching a gasket's material—such as stainless steel or graphite—and its serration pattern to factors like temperature fluctuations, chemical exposure, and vibration levels. By tailoring your choice to these specifics, you can avoid costly downtime and safety hazards, making the upfront effort well worth it.
One common pitfall is assuming that all serrated gaskets are interchangeable; each type offers distinct advantages. For example, a spiral-wound gasket with serrations provides flexibility for systems with thermal cycling, as it can absorb some movement without losing seal integrity. On the other hand, a solid metal serrated gasket might be better suited for static, high-pressure applications where minimal creep is crucial. Don't overlook surface finish compatibility either—a rough flange might require deeper serrations to embed properly, while smoother surfaces might need shallower teeth to avoid damage. By analyzing your system's operational quirks, you can zero in on a gasket that not only seals but enhances overall performance.
Beyond technical specs, practical installation and maintenance insights can make or break your gasket's effectiveness. Always ensure flange faces are clean and aligned before installation, as debris or misalignment can compromise the serration's bite, leading to premature failure. Consider using a torque sequence recommended by manufacturers to apply even pressure, which helps the serrated edges distribute stress uniformly. For maintenance, regularly inspect gaskets for signs of wear, such as flattened serrations or corrosion, especially in harsh environments like chemical processing plants. By adopting these hands-on tips, you'll not only choose the right serrated gasket but optimize its lifespan, reducing the need for frequent replacements and boosting system efficiency.
